The way it works is that you get your ticket (I’d recommend going online the day before so you can get the timeslot you want entrance is hourly). You then wait in a ‘meeting area’. When it’s your time to enter, one of the guides divides the big groups up into large groups, then you go through the turnstile and have your ticket scanned, you meet your guide (don’t go in Nate’s group!), then you start the descent. There are a couple stops during the tour for questions and explanations. At the end of the tour you can head two different ways 1) out and 2) more walking into another cave and also you can walk to the bridge over the waterfall. No photos allowed. All beautiful.
